Witnesses Testify Against Jones

Forest County Sheriff's Dept.

More witnesses testified Wednesday in the Ray Jones trial at Crandon. Jones is charged with attempted homicide for his role in severely beating Steven Roberts and leaving him for the wolves to kill along a Forest County ATV trail in sub-freezing weather.

Overall, 9 Deputies, medical staff, and eyewitnesses to the crimes testified Wednesday. One of them is the man Jones' attorney says is really responsible for the beating. Justin Bey admitted hitting Roberts, but says it was Jones that kicked Roberts in the ribs, back, head, and stomach. During the investigation, Jones told officers it was Bey who severely beat Roberts and not him.

Justin Bey will be back on the witness stand Thursday, as the prosecution wraps up its case. Bey is already in jail awaiting sentencing for his part in the beating. He is testifying against Jones as part of a plea deal.
The defense is expected to begin their case later in the day.

The events that led to holding Roberts against his will, beating him, and leaving him for dead are allegedly because Roberts inappropriately touched a child Jones knows. More on that is expected during defense testimony.
